>> > Running http://cppcheck.wiki.sourceforge.net/ reports:
>> >
>> > [lib/toutf8.c:122]: (always) Memory leak: p
>> >
>> > for version 1.12 of libidn
>>
>> Hi.  Thanks for the report.  I would say it is a false positive, the
>> code reads:
>>
>> ...
>>  * Return value: Returns newly allocated zero-terminated string which
>>  *   is @str transcoded into to_codeset.
>>  **/
>> char *
>> stringprep_convert (const char *str,
>>                    const char *to_codeset, const char *from_codeset)
>> {
>> #if HAVE_ICONV
>>  return str_iconv (str, from_codeset, to_codeset);
>> #else
>>  char *p;
>>  fprintf (stderr, "libidn: warning: libiconv not installed, cannot "
>>           "convert data to UTF-8\n");
>>  p = malloc (strlen (str) + 1);
>>  if (!p)
>>    return NULL;
>>  return strcpy (p, str);
>> #endif
>> }
>>
>> I'm assuming you've tested the !HAVE_ICONV code path.
>>
>> The function is documented to return a pointer to newly allocated
>> storage.  If the function is used as documented, and the caller
>> de-allocate the string after use, I don't see how there is a memory
>> leak.  What do you think?
